Implement switchConnectable with Powered property setting instead of scan modes
Bluez powered property setting is more apropriate for what this method intend to achieve and it fixes a bug that incoming connection request wake up the stack in The pairable events are replaced by power and discoverable events HotOff state bug 5080232 Change-Id: I43b44cb2f5203bd99bf764d5a1696e8ff52a31db
